Possible Dangers and Side Effects
Prior to selecting LASIK eye surgical treatment, it is very important to think about the potential risks and side effects connected with the procedure. Here are some key points to keep in mind:
- Dry eyes: It prevails to experience dry skin after the surgical treatment, yet this usually enhances over time. Eye goes down or man-made tears may be required to manage this adverse effects.
- Halos and glare: Some individuals may observe enhanced sensitivity to light, glare, or halos around bright items, specifically during the night.
- Undercorrection or overcorrection: There is a possibility that your vision might not be completely dealt with, which might call for added treatments or continued use of glasses or get in touch with lenses.
- Flap complications: Throughout LASIK surgical procedure, a thin flap is developed on the cornea. Although unusual, there is a possibility that the flap might not recover appropriately, causing vision troubles.
- Long-lasting effects: While LASIK is typically considered secure, there is restricted long-lasting information on its impacts. If you have any kind of problems, it is important to review them with your doctor.
Elements to Take Into Consideration Prior To Undergoing LASIK Surgical Treatment
Before deciding to go through LASIK surgical procedure, it's important to consider various factors that may influence your total experience as well as results.
First of all, consider your age and prescription security. LASIK is most efficient for individuals matured 18 to 40, whose prescriptions have actually remained stable for at least two years.
Next off, review your eye wellness. Problems like dry eye syndrome, glaucoma, or cataracts might influence the result of the surgical treatment.
Additionally, assess your assumptions as well as lifestyle. LASIK can substantially enhance your vision, but it may not completely get rid of the need for glasses or call lenses. If you engage in tasks that boost the risk of eye injury, such as get in touch with sports or a physically demanding career, LASIK may not be the very best option for you.
Finally, research and also pick a trusted specialist with substantial experience in LASIK procedures.
